26
Curtis 1030 Acuity Manual, Rev. C
8 — DEVICE MONITOR OBJECTS
The data recorded per the events in Bytes 42 – 51 is as follows.
BATTERY CYCLE EVENT
BYTE DESCRIPTION END OF CHARGE POWER DOWN
byte42 Batterycyclenumber(LSB). EoC_V_LSB PowerDown_sec
byte43 Batterycyclenumber(MSB). EoC_V_MSB _min
byte44 TotalAhchargeforbatterycycle(LSB). EoC_I_LSB _hour
byte45 TotalAhchargeforbatterycycle(MSB). EoC_I_MSB PowerDown_Day
byte46 TotalAhdischargeforbatterycycle(LSB). [notused] _Month
byte47 TotalAhdischargeforbatterycycle(MSB). [notused] _Year
byte 48 Max temperature for battery cycle. [not used] [not used]
byte 49 Min temperature for battery cycle. [not used] [not used]
byte50 5Hrratecapacityavailable(LSB). [notused] [notused]
byte51 5Hrratecapacityavailable(MSB). [notused] [notused]
Retrieving historical records
Historical records are generated for four different events (see page 23). To find
the precise historical data location where the data cycle has been recorded, use
the following steps. This way data for any cycle number can be retrieved without
a search through all the historical records. The retrieval starts with a request
to 5302h to find the record number. (See also, chart at bottom of page 23.)
The Acuity response to this request is as follows.
INDEX SUB-INDEX ACCESS BYTE 5 BYTE 6 BYTE 7 BYTE 8 DESCRIPTION
5302h 00h RO Cycle number Cycle number 0 0 Read historical record.
(LSB) (MSB)
Byte 1 Byte 2 Byte 3 Byte 4 Byte 5 Byte 6 Byte 7 Byte 8
40h 02h 53h 00h Historical Historical 0 0
Record Record
Number Number
(LSB) (MSB)
After the historic record number is received, specific details for that record can
be retrieved, using the SDO object Historic Record Request (5300h), along
with the appropriate sub-index.
INDEX SUB-INDEX ACCESS BYTE 5 BYTE 6 BYTE 7 BYTE 8 DESCRIPTION
5300h 00..15h RO Record number Record number 0 0 Read historical record.
(LSB) (MSB)